Catalog description

Emphasize the techniques of modular program design and development in a structured, language independent manner. Includes problems analysis and their solution, in such a way that the computer can be directed to follow the problem–solving procedure. Pseudocode, flowcharts, and other diagrams are used to develop the problem -solving algorithms with three basic control structures: sequence, selection, and repetition . The course consists of 45 hours of lectures and 45 hours of laboratory.
